1.17 Logbook
The FE-800 stores log data at five second intervals, with a maximum log period of 24 hours.
Once the maximum number of entries is reached, the oldest entry is deleted to make room for the
youngest entry.
The logbook is capable of displaying data a maximum of 720 log entries, depending on the display
interval.
How to display the logbook
To display the logbook, do the following:
1. Press the MENU/ESC key to open the Main menu.
2. Select [DISPLAY] using or , then press the ENT key.
3. Select [LOGBOOK] using or , then press the ENT key.
4. Press or to change the page currently displayed.
5. Press the DISP key to close the logbook.
How to change the logging interval
The logging interval for each entry can be adjusted in the menu by doing the following:
1. Press the MENU/ESC key to open the Main menu.
2. Select [Display] using or , then press the ENT key.
3. Select [Interval] using or then press the ENT key. The Interval settings pop-up window
will open.
4. Choose the appropriate interval (5 s - 1 hour max., 1 min - 12 hours max., 2 min - 24 hours
max.) using or , then press the ENT key to apply the settings and close the pop-up win-
dow.
5. Press the MENU/ESC key twice to close the menu.
Note: Changing the interval will change the data available to be displayed in the LOGBOOK.
Display interval Time to display Time to record
5 seconds 1 hour 24 hours
1 minute 12 hours 24 hours
2 minutes 24 hours 24 hours
